dc.description.abstractGraph drawing addresses the problem of constructing geometric representations of graphs. The automatic generation of drawing of graphs has many applications such as information visualization, VLSI, software engineering, biology and chemistry. This thesis presents new drawing algorithms for phylogenetic trees. One of the central problems in biology is to explain the evolutionary history of current species and, in particular, how species relate to one another in terms of common ancestors. This is usually done by constructing trees, whose represent current species and whose interior nodes represent hypothesized ancestors. These kinds of trees are called phylogenetic trees. Our drawing algorithm draws phylogenetic trees with even distribution of nodes and very efficient use of the drawing area. Also, the methods for drawing large phylogenetic trees are presented. We also design and implement the Phylogenetic Tree Drawing System (PTDS) based on WWW. In PTDS, various drawing algorithms are implemented for phylogenetic trees including our new drawing algorithms. The use of Java and the WWW in its implementation makes the system globally available regardless of computer platform details. PTDS can be used in biology, especially in phylogenetic systematics.;그래프 드로잉은 추상적인 그래프를 시각적으로 구성하여 2차원 평면상에 그려주는 작업으로서 좋은 드로잉은 그래프가 가진 여러 특성을 빠르게 이해할 수 있게 해 준다. 그래프를 드로잉 할 때 대상 그래프를 이해하기 용이하면서 면적의 효율성을 갖도록 드로잉을 구축하는 것은 매우 중요한 문제이다. 본 논문에서는 생물학 분야에서 유용하게 자주 사용하는 계통 트리(phylogenetic tree)를 드로잉의 대상으로 하여 면적을 최대한 효율적으로 사용하며 각 개체간의 간격을 동일하게 유지하는 새로운 드로잉 알고리즘과 대형 계통 트리를 효율적으로 드로잉하는 방법을 제시한다. 이를 기반으로 하여 기존의 계통 트리 드로잉 알고리즘과 본 논문에서 제안된 새로운 계통 트리 드로잉 알고리즘 등의 다양한 드로잉 방법을 지원하는 웹 기반의 계통 트리 드로잉 시스템(Phylogenetic Tree Drawing System. PTDS)을 구현하였다. 본 시스템은 자바를 사용하여 구현되었기 때문에 어떤 컴퓨터 플랫폼에도 구애됨 없이 웹 브라우저를 통해서 자유롭고 쉽게 실행될 수 있다. 따라서 사용자에게 접근 및 사용의 편리함을 제공한다. PTDS는 생물학, 특히 계통분류학 분야의 연구에 매우 유용하게 사용될 수 있다.-
dc.description.tableofcontents그림목차 = v 논문개요 = viii I. 서론 = 1 II. 계통 트리 = 5 2.1 계통 트리의 정의 및 특성 = 5 2.2 계통 트리의 기존 드로잉 = 7 III. 계통 트리 드로잉 = 10 3.1 트리 드로잉 알고리즘 = 10 3.1.1 일반 트리 드로잉 = 10 3.1.2 방사형 드로잉 = 11 3.2 계통 트리 드로잉 알고리즘 = 15 IV. 대형 계통 트리 드로잉 = 25 4.1 대형 그래프 드로잉 = 25 4.2 대형 계통 트리의 드로잉 기법 = 27 4.2.1 용어 정의 = 27 4.2.2 대형 계통 트리 드로잉 알고리즘 = 30 V. 계통 트리 드로잉 시스템 = 35 5.1 시스템의 설계 = 35 5.1.1 입력 및 출력부 = 36 5.1.2 관리자부 = 38 5.1.3 계통 트리 드로잉부 = 39 5.1.4 형태 장식부 = 41 5.1.5 연산 처리부 = 42 5.2 시스템의 구현 결과 = 42 5.2.1 메뉴 설명 = 44 5.2.2 적용 결과 = 47 VI. 결론 및 향후 연구 과제 = 55 참고문헌 = 56 영문초록 = 58-
계통 트리 드로잉 알고리즘에 관한 연구 및 시스템 구현
